This report analyses the effects of climate change on French fishery resources and the responses developed to adapt their management. Ocean warming, acidification and deoxygenation are altering plankton productivity, and the physiology and distribution of exploited species, leading to latitudinal shifts of communities and an expected decline in global fisheries productivity of 10 to 30% by 2100. In response to these changes, fisheries management tools are evolving to incorporate the variability and non-stationarity of ecosystems, but more often implicitly than through the explicit inclusion of environmental variables. Mechanistic approaches and management strategy simulations (MSEs) are promising tools for quantifying climate effects and adapting reference points and harvest control rules for fisheries sustainability. The research projects carried out by Ifremer and its partners – both in mainland France and overseas – illustrate this dynamic of knowledge progress, combining observation, experimentation and modelling. This work contributes directly to the implementation of ecosystem-based and adaptive fisheries management, in support of national and European public policies for adaptation to climate change.
